Netflix’s Free Bert Season 2: How to Audition for the Hit Comedy Series

Overview

Netflix’s comedy series Free Bert is returning for Season 2, and casting opportunities are now emerging for background actors, stand-ins, and specialty talent.

The series stars comedian Bert Kreischer as a fictionalized version of himself in a chaotic family comedy about trying to fit into an elite Beverly Hills world. After his daughters are accepted into a prestigious private school, Bert and his family quickly discover that blending in with wealthy, image-conscious parents is not as easy as it looks.

With its mix of raunchy comedy, family drama, social awkwardness, and over-the-top situations, Free Bert has become a standout Netflix comedy for fans of Bert Kreischer’s unfiltered style.

Now, Season 2 is moving forward, giving aspiring actors and performers a chance to work on a major streaming production.

Production Details

Project: Free Bert Season 2
Platform: Netflix
Genre: Scripted comedy series
Starring: Bert Kreischer, Arden Myrin, Ava Ryan, Lilou Lang
Creators: Bert Kreischer, Jarrad Paul, Andy Mogel
Production Location: Atlanta, Georgia
Casting: Background actors, stand-ins, and specialty talent
Current Status: Season 2 renewed / casting opportunities emerging

What Is Free Bert About?

Free Bert follows Bert Kreischer, playing a fictional version of himself, as he tries to become a better family man while adjusting to a high-status Beverly Hills lifestyle.

When Bert’s daughters begin attending an elite private school, the family enters a world filled with strict social rules, wealthy parents, school politics, and image-conscious expectations. Bert’s loud, honest, and unpredictable personality quickly makes things complicated.

Season 1 introduced viewers to the Kreischer family’s attempt to fit into their new environment while staying true to themselves. Season 2 is expected to continue exploring the family’s messy adjustment to elite school life, social pressure, and Bert’s constant struggle to do the right thing without making everything worse.

Netflix’s Free Bert Season 2 Casting Opportunities

Casting opportunities for Free Bert Season 2 may include background actors, stand-ins, and specialty roles for scenes set in schools, gyms, social spaces, and community environments.

According to current casting details, production is seeking both returning performers and new faces for potential recurring work throughout the season.

Possible roles may include:

  • High school students
  • Students who can portray younger age ranges
  • High school wrestlers
  • Middle school wrestlers
  • Athletic gym-goers
  • Spin class participants
  • Dive bar patrons
  • Teachers
  • Upscale and wealthy-looking individuals
  • General background actors
  • Stand-ins for principal cast members

Because the show takes place around an elite school and upper-class social environment, casting may need performers who can convincingly portray students, parents, teachers, athletes, and wealthy community members.

Who Can Apply?

Casting opportunities for Free Bert Season 2 are open to a range of talent, including new and experienced background actors.

Talent should be comfortable working on a professional television set and able to follow direction from production staff and assistant directors.

Applicants may be a good fit if they have:

  • Acting experience
  • Background acting experience
  • Stand-in experience
  • Wrestling experience
  • Athletic ability
  • A polished, upscale look
  • Availability for filming in Atlanta
  • Reliable transportation
  • Professional on-set behavior

For wrestler-specific roles, previous wrestling experience may be preferred. For stand-in opportunities, casting teams may look for talent who match the height, build, complexion, and general look of principal actors.

Step 4: Be Available and Professional

Background acting jobs often require long filming days. Talent should be prepared to arrive on time, follow instructions, remain quiet during filming, and maintain continuity between takes.

Professionalism matters. Being reliable, responsive, and prepared can increase your chances of being considered for future scenes or recurring background work.
